Customizable WordPress installer to make your life easier
Switch branches/tags
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
src
.editorconfig
.gitattributes
.gitignore
LICENSE.txt
composer.json
composer.lock
config.yml
notes.md
phpunit.xml
press
readme.md
todo.md

readme.md

Latest Stable Version License composer.lock Scrutinizer Code Quality Build Status Dependency Status

SensioLabsInsight

#Press CLI Press CLI is a WordPress installer to help you get up an running faster. It installs WordPress, themes, plugins and more! With the ability to set sane defaults for all your projects with the ability to customize on a prer project basis is need. Learn more about Press CLI at https://pressc.li/.

Requirements

Install

  1. Install Composer if not already installed.
  2. Install PHP if not already installed, you can use Homebrew to easily install PHP.
    • Install Hombrew or if Homebrew was already installed make sure it is up to date via brew update.
    • Install PHP 7.0 via brew install homebrew/php/php70.
  3. Install Press CLI via composer global require dholloran/press-cli.
  4. Install Laravel Valet

Usage

  1. $ press configure --global creates the global configuration file at ~/.press-cli.json. Note: The global configuration will also be created if it does not exist by the press new and press configure commands
  2. press new <project-name> creates a local .press-cli.json and runs the instal.
  3. press configure <project-name> creates a local configuration without running the install.
  4. press install runs the install process if a .press-cli.json exists in the current directory.

Attribution